The Historic Bath of Siba

The Historical Bath of Siba – Hamam Sibah (Persian: حمام سیبه), is a historical bathing complex of the ancient Sassanid culture, located in present-day southern Iran near the Straits of Hormuz.

Ancient Sassanians built public baths to serve as rest centers.

The baths served Sassanid government officials, the merchants from nearby sea ports and desert caravan routes, and the public.

Some of the baths had practitioners who offered healing treatments, using medicinal herbs and essential oils.

The baths were known as the 'dumb doctor' because healers also treated patients silently with its healing hot spring waters.
